Blue Orchid definitive stamp from Australia, issued in 2003 in "Nature of Australia: Rainforests" series. The sc. name is Dendrobium nindii, & in Australia it is found in north eastern Queensland.  |

I hope more people will show their orchid stamps here!  Orchid stamps from the Philippines. These stamps were issued in 1996 for AseanPex '96. At lower right is Vanda javierii or V. javierae, a rare white vanda orchid, found only in the island of Luzon.  |

1966 Rhodesia definitive stamp on 1967 letter to England. "Ansellia Orchid" (SG 382) is the Ansellia gigantea, known as African Ansellia or leopard orchid, a native species from tropical & South Africa.  |

This Singapore miniature sheet was issued in 1995 to commemorate Singapore '95 World Stamp Exhibition . The 2 orchids depicted are a Vanda hybrid (Vanda Marlie Dolera) & a wild orchid (Vanda limbata, which is native to Java, the Lesser Sunda Islands, & the Philippines). Various mammals & flora of the Malayan region are shown on the sheet.  |

Canada issued this set for the 1999 World Orchid Conference held in Vancouver. Issued in Booklets of 12 and Souvenir sheets. Scott 1790a showing part of a booklet and inscription on inside cover.   Scott 1790b Souvenir Sheet  Scott 1787  Scott 1788  Scott 1789  Scott 1790  |

This stamp is part of a 2012 2-stamp issue from Singapore to mark the launch of Gardens by the Bay, a major tourist attraction. Shown in the stamp are 2 uniquely designed hothouses displaying all types of plants and flowers from all over the world. Beautiful orchids decorates the foreground. Scott 1554.  |

An orchid stamp FDC issued in 2011 in French Polynesia, with the orchid fragrance infused in the stamp.  |

This special souvenir sheet released on 13 August 2013 by Singapore has the theme: " Our City in a Garden". The design features 3 orchids, the Grammatophyllum speciosum (tiger orchid), the Cymbidium bicolor, and the Dendrobium leonis. The same design is also broken into 4 parts in a 4-stamp set in the same issue, with the 1st 2 values released in self-adhesive formats. This souvenir sheet has attached to it some seeds of the Porticulata grandiflora (moss rose), located on the left side just off the pangolin.  |

Schomburgkia thomsoniana, engraved and printed by Bradbury, Wilkinson & Co., Ltd., and issued for use in Cayman Islands on November 28, 1962, Scott No. 155, plus a photo of one of these orchids. - nethyrk  |
